find a set of parametric equations of the line the line pases through the point (2,3,4) and is parallel to the xz-plane and the
joja [24]

Answer:

x=2, y=3, z=4+t

Step-by-step explanation:

For this case we need a line parallel to the plane x z and yz. And by definition of parallel we see that the intersection between the xz and yz plane is the z axis. And we can take the following unitary vector to construct the parametric equations:

u= (u_x, u_y, u_z)= (0,0,1)

Or any factor of u but for simplicity let's take the unitary vector.

Then the parametric equations are given by:

x= P_x + u_x t

y= P_y + u_y t

z= P_z + u_z t

Where the point given P=(2,3,4)= (P_x , P_y, P_z)

And then since we have everything we can replace like this:

x= P_x + u_x t 2+ 0*t = 2

y= P_y + u_y t= 3+ 0*t = 3

z= P_z + u_z t = 4+ 1t = 4+t

x=2, y=3, z=4+t

Which statement best describes the polynomial 2x + 8?
weeeeeb [17]
There are two (2) terms, "2x" and "8", making it a "binomial" (the "bi" prefix meaning "two"). The only variable is x, and its power is 1, making the "2x" term a first-degree term. Since the highest degree of any term is 1, the polynomial is first degree.

Selection A is appropriate.
